Before going the clean uninstall route -

1. Where did you download the software?

2. What is the size of your compressed 001 and 002 downloads?

2015 downloads.PNG

 

3. Run MS EXcel once.

4. Set UAC to lowest setting and reboot.

5. Turn off anti-virus.

6. Go to Control Panel and right click on Inventor and do a Repair Install.

 

Report back here.
